*Trail has seen significant improvements, and re-routes*
Ride at your own risk.


The trail has blowdown, failed wood features, and drainage issues.

Historic description.
Steep technical trail with a fair amount of ladder bridges and steep sections with lots of roots. Grin and Holler was buffed top to bottom in 2011, 100% volunteer effort.

Access Info

Take the Garabaldi park gravel road past the 2nd switchback where you will find a parking area on the left of the road 100m past the switchback. Ride down the doubletrack trail from there about 450m and you will see the trail on your left.
